The Aydin Group at LMU Munich was recently featured in SAT.1 Bayern's documentary on the future of next-generation solar technology. The segment spotlights our work on perovskite-based tandem and multijunction solar cells engineered to withstand the harsh conditions of low Earth orbit — radiation exposure, extreme thermal cycling, and the vacuum of space.

While silicon-based photovoltaics dominate terrestrial markets, perovskite devices offer a compelling route to ultra-lightweight, high-efficiency power generation for satellites and space infrastructure. Our group focuses on interface engineering and stability strategies that bridge the gap between laboratory performance and operational robustness in both terrestrial and space environments.
